Lord Mayor praises bonfire group's example

12.00.00am BST (GMT +0100) Wed 16th Jun 2004

ALLIANCE Councillor and Belfast Lord Mayor Tom Ekin has said he welcomes moves by loyalists in north Belfast's Westland estate to clean up their area for the Twelfth.

Cllr Ekin said: "Everyone has a right to celebrate their culture, but how it is done is equally important. With rights come responsibilities, and it is very encouraging to hear of new initiatives in loyalist areas where people are taking pride in their area's appearance.

"The work in removing paramilitary flags, sectarian murals and painting over kerbstones is very welcome, and the wider community will appreciate this progressive move.

"If the Westland residents can make their Twelfth celebrations more family-orientated, taking greater responsibility for the comfort and safety of everyone in the area, that deserves to be commended. I would encourage other areas to take a leaf out of the Westland community's book, as unfortunately some parts of Belfast are more reminiscent of a rubbish tip than a bonfire site."
